Sections of Interstate 95 collapsed into the Turtle River, flood waters swept over Brunswick streets and fierce winds reduced homes on St. Simons Island to splinters. Hurricane Claire, the fictitious Atlantic storm selected for a practice exercise Thursday by emergency responders, barreled ashore as a bruising Category 4 hurricane before dawn Saturday at the county line between Glynn and Camden, bringing devastation not witnessed in this area since the deadly storm of 1898. Claire’s fury raged throughout day and into Saturday night, riding in on a high tide to wreak untold havoc and threaten the lives of thousands.
